EMIDIO, Thassia Souza; OKAMOTO, Mary Yoko; MAIA, Bruna Bortolozzi  y  RODRIGUES, Raissa Pinto. Idealization of motherhood and psychic heritage: reflections in the contemporary. Vínculo [online]. 2023, vol.20, n.1, pp.3-15.  Epub 20-Sep-2024. ISSN 1806-2490.  https://doi.org/10.32467/issn.1982-1492v20n1a2.

Noticing the history transformations in motherhood, and the current identity crisis in the woman's relationship between femininity and maternity, that is, the conflict between the ideas of motherhood related to the figure of the woman/mother and the contemporary demands of individual realization at work, this exploratory-descriptive, cross-sectional, study of a qualitative approach was carried out, whose objective was to describe and analyze, from the perspective of psychoanalysis of the linking configurations, the experience of mothers who abandoned the professional career for the exclusive dedication to motherhood. Eight middle-class women, aged between 30 and 50, who were mothers and abandoned their professional careers to dedicate themselves to motherhood-retirar, were interviewed. The interviews that composed the results were transcribed, and thematic content analyses pointed out the multiple demands, both social and related to psychic heritage, which have implications for the identity construction of these women. We conclude that an elaboration of this heritage requires a link network of support and presupposes the non-idealization of motherhood, understanding it as plural, both in the sense of being multiple and diverse, and in the sense of being a bonding construction.
